Once done, simply select “Create MIDI Track,” and that’s it. If you installed Logic Pro, you have to activate the Flex Pitch function. If you’re using FL Studio, you simply need to import your audio file and click on the "Edit Sample."Ī new window will pop up, where you will have to select "Tools" and then click "Convert to Score." Once you’ve done that, your MIDI track is ready to go. Your options are Drums, Melody, and Harmony. Then, choose the appropriate conversion command for your clip. If you're using Ableton, for example, you start by selecting the clip from the Arrangement Views, Session, or the Live's browser. How To Convert Audio to MIDI in Easy Steps Using a MIDI sequence of your audio recording, you can unite musical instruments by changing the pitch, velocity, cues, notation, tempo, and other properties. You’d be able to do all of these in just a few mouse clicks.Īudio-to-MIDI conversions have many other creative applications, too. You can tune up an existing guitar line into a piece of super high-pitched music or a very low-frequency bass line.
Once you've converted your audio recording to a MIDI sequence, you can work on different bass sounds until you find the perfect one. You can synth MIDI information to create sounds from all sorts of instruments, too. Note that this isn’t just applicable to keyboards. You can simply make a recording using a familiar instrument and use the MIDI information to make it sound like real music from a keyboard. If you wish to incorporate this instrument without the need to find a good keyboardist to play a midi keyboard or master the instrument yourself, a quick audio-to-MIDI file conversion should do the trick. Maybe you’re a great vocalist, a sax player, or a guitarist, but you don’t play the keyboard too well. You can also use it to polish vocal overdubs and make your output much better.
One major benefit of learning how to convert audio to MIDI is it gives you greater control to edit your music.įor example, if you created some voice recording via the microphone, you can switch it into a MIDI file and edit to adjust the pitch, length, and tune.
